Rubric data can be viewed in several places across Schoolbox. These views help teachers review student achievement, track progress against capabilities and indicators, and prepare reporting outcomes.

This page explains where rubric results can be viewed, filtered, downloaded, and included in reports.

Rubric Report

The Rubric Report shows rubric results for a specific activity.

  1. Navigate to an activity that uses a rubric.
  2. Select the three-dot menu.
  3. Select Rubric Report.

The report displays rubric capabilities, indicators, descriptor selections, and overall results for students in the activity.

Rubric Markbook

The Rubric Markbook shows rubric achievement across multiple activities in a class.

  1. Go to the class page.
  2. Select the three-dot menu.
  3. Select Rubric Markbook.

Use the Rubric Markbook to filter results by term, unit, activity status, weighting, work type, capability, or indicator.

Select Show Drafts to include draft rubric feedback that has not been published.

Download Rubric Results

Rubric results can be downloaded from rubric reporting views where downloads are available.

In the Rubric Markbook, you can download:

  • Rubric Points
  • Rubric Descriptors

If Show Drafts is selected before downloading, draft feedback is included in the spreadsheet.

Rubrics in Feedback and Grades

Rubric feedback can also appear on student feedback and grades pages after feedback has been published.

  • Teachers can review rubric selections from the activity feedback view.
  • Students and parents can view published rubric feedback where visibility settings allow.
  • Grades pages can show rubric learning levels, descriptors, capability marks, and progression where configured.

Visibility depends on the activity feedback settings, grades settings, and year level configuration.

Rubrics in Summative Reports

Rubric information can be included in Summative Reports where the report and work type settings allow.

Depending on your report configuration, Summative Reports can include marked rubric grids and capability totals.

Summative Report visibility and release rules still apply.

The Rubric Markbook allows any staff member in your school to view student achievements against the rubrics you’ve created and assigned to an assessment item in Schoolbox.  Teachers can view the results for a specific capability or indicator, across multiple assessments, in one location! This is particularly helpful when you want a quick snapshot of student progress in a specific area, or when you need to form an overall mark for your end of semester reports! The Rubric Markbook can be filtered by capability and indicator.

Superusers will need to go to Administration > LMS > Settings - LMS Policy to review the decisions relating to Rubrics, with the Teaching and Learning Leaders.

Access from your My Classes page

1. Select the 'Classes' tab in your top menu.

2. Select the 3-dot menu next to the class.

3. Select 'Rubric Markbook'.

Access from your Class Page

1. Navigate to your Class Page.

2. Select the 3-dot menu at the top right of your page.

3. Select 'Rubric Markbook'.

The Rubric Markbook allows you to track the achievements of a student across the rubrics you have used. The Rubric Markbook will display each assessment and the capabilities and indicators that were used to assess the task.

The overall grade of a rubric can be viewed by navigating to the Overall section of the markbook. This will display the default grade group selected within Administration > Lists > Year Levels.

The Rubric Markbook allows you to filter by the term, unit, activity status, weighting, work type, or capabilities and indicators. You can also use the Drafts checkbox to display draft marks that have not been published.

In addition to being viewable inside Schoolbox, Rubric Points and Rubric Descriptors can be downloaded as a spreadsheet. 

To download:

1. Go to your Rubric Markbook.

2. Use the ‘Show Drafts’ checkbox to decide if you wish to include draft feedback and grading in your download.

NOTE: If drafts are included in the download, the word ‘Draft’ will be prepended to the file name. Draft points and descriptors within the spreadsheet will have ‘(draft)’ amended to them.

3. Select the 3-dot menu to the top right of the page.

4. Select 'Download Rubric Points' or 'Rubric Descriptors'.
